Derramar means to spill or pour out a liquid or substance, often unintentionally. It can also be used metaphorically to refer to spreading or dispersing something.
El Presente de Subjuntivo - used to talk about situations of uncertainty, or emotions such as wishes, desires and hopes

Pronoun | Conjugation |
---|---|
Yo | derrame |
Tú | derrames |
Él / Ella / Usted | derrame |
Nosotros / Nosotras | derramemos |
Vosotros / Vosotras | derraméis |
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es | derramen |
